Carnegie Mellon University (CMU) has announced that it plans to send the first American unmanned rover to the Moon in July 2021. The miniature four-wheeled robot will ride aboard the Peregrine lander along with 14 other scientific payloads and will carry a miniature art gallery on its journey.

A NASA study of the Titan Submarine Phase I Conceptual Design outlines a possible mission to Saturn's largest moon, Titan, where the unmanned submersible would explore the seas of liquid hydrocarbons at the Titanian poles.

Curious about what's living on the deep sea floor? Well, the Autosub6000 AUV (autonomous underwater vehicle) is helping us find out. It's claimed to be far more effective at identifying deep-sea life than the usual approach of scientific trawling.

A secret mission came to a public end as the US Air Force’s top secret X-37B spaceplane landed at Vandenberg Air Force Base in California. The unmanned reusable spacecraft touched down on the runway like a conventional aircraft this morning at 9:24 am EDT after a record-breaking 674 days in orbit.

The private effort to recover the 35-year old ISEE-3 spacecraft has ended in apparent failure. The engines failed to fire properly to make the planned course correction and the craft will head back into deep space.

Sierra Nevada Corporation carried out the first gliding approach and landing test of their Dream Chaser spacecraft last Saturday. While tests of gliding and landing maneuvers went flawlessly, the left landing gear did not deploy, causing the test spacecraft to flip on landing.
